What is the Civic Leadership Program?
The Hands On Atlanta Civic Leadership Program, powered by Constellation, trains volunteers while supporting the needs of nonprofit agencies. Participants begin as Civic Fellows and become Civic Leaders through ongoing leadership training and mentoring provided by Hands On Atlanta staff, alumni and partners.

THE DISCOVERY PROGRAM AT BROOKVIEW ELEMENTARY SCHOOL
Discovery is an engaging Saturday morning enrichment program which offers STEAM, Social Emotional Learning, Fitness, and Health activities to metro Atlanta’s K-5 youth. Discovery is Hands On Atlanta’s longest running program and offers community volunteers a meaningful and interactive service experience.
Hands On Atlanta partners with over 10 Title 1 elementary schools, serving nearly 1,000 students a school year. The program operates, on average, two Saturdays a month September-May. In addition to fun and educational activities, all students receive breakfast and take-home snacks at each Discovery session.
